Judith Leiber Heart Snake Miniaudiere

Symbolizing temptation and eroticism, the snake has been a creature of great mystery. Judith Leiber touches on the temptation of the snake, as it was used to tempt Eve and take over her heart. To an outsider, the Judith Leiber Heart & Snake Miniaudiere is simple, but the symbolism runs deep, alluding to sin and evil along with lust and eroticism. The Austrian black crystal embellishments take over the heart, showing it is dark and tainted, with the silver-tone snake overture and hardware. Beyond symbolism, this miniaudiere features and optional chain strap, double-sided mirror, and matching coin purse. This piece is a conversation piece, used to get people thinking. Some may be offended, some may take it lightly, but either way this piece has symbolism that runs much deeper than merely an evening bag. Pre-order via Neiman Marcus for $1995.
